Start your trip in the vibrant city of Barcelona. In the morning, visit the iconic Sagrada Familia and marvel at its impressive architecture. Afternoon can be spent exploring the historic Gothic Quarter, with its narrow streets and charming squares. In the evening, head to La Rambla, a bustling pedestrian street filled with shops, restaurants, and street performers.
Travel to the coastal city of Valencia. In the morning, visit the futuristic City of Arts and Sciences, home to an opera house, science museum, and oceanarium. Spend the afternoon exploring the historic Central Market, where you can sample local delicacies. As the evening approaches, relax at Malvarrosa Beach and enjoy the beautiful sunset.
Head to the capital city, Madrid. Start the day by visiting the magnificent Royal Palace and its stunning gardens. In the afternoon, explore the famous Prado Museum, home to a vast collection of European art. As the evening sets in, take a leisurely stroll along Gran Via, Madrid's main shopping street, and soak in the vibrant atmosphere.
Travel to the enchanting city of Seville. Start the day by visiting the historic Alcázar of Seville, a stunning palace with beautiful gardens. In the afternoon, explore the charming neighborhood of Santa Cruz, known for its narrow streets and colorful patios. As the evening approaches, experience the vibrant atmosphere of Triana, a lively district famous for flamenco dancing.
Visit the captivating city of Granada. In the morning, explore the magnificent Alhambra, a palace and fortress complex with stunning Moorish architecture. Afternoon can be spent wandering through the Albaicín neighborhood, known for its narrow cobblestone streets and breathtaking views. As the evening sets in, indulge in delicious tapas at one of the local bars.
Travel to the coastal city of Malaga. Start the day by exploring the Picasso Museum, dedicated to the famous artist. In the afternoon, visit La Malagueta Beach and relax by the crystal-clear waters. As the evening approaches, wander through the charming historic center of Malaga, filled with shops, restaurants, and lively squares.
End your trip in the vibrant city of Bilbao. In the morning, visit the iconic Guggenheim Museum, known for its modern and contemporary art collection. Afternoon can be spent exploring the Casco Viejo, the historic quarter of Bilbao, with its charming streets and traditional Basque cuisine. As the evening sets in, enjoy a stroll along the riverfront and admire the stunning architecture.
While exploring Spain, don't miss the hidden gems and local favorites. In Barcelona, visit Park Güell for breathtaking views and unique architecture. In Seville, explore the vibrant Triana Market for fresh local produce and delicious tapas. And in Bilbao, take a day trip to San Juan de Gaztelugatxe, a stunning coastal spot featured in the TV series "Game of Thrones".
